Gurgaon School of Music, the first branch of Performers’ Collective, was established in April 2003 by Mr. Jack Thomas and Mr. Ritesh Khokhar. With over 600 students studying 18 different disciplines, Performers' Collective is presently the largest private institute of music and performing arts in Delhi and NCR.

Performers' Collective is the first institute in the country to formalize schooling for contemporary music by following the syllabus of Rockschool, London. The international examinations for rockschool are conducted by Trinity College London.


Performers' Collective offers the syllabi of Trinity College London, Associated Board of Royal Schools of Music (ABRSM), Rockschool, Prayag Sangeet Samiti, Allahabad. Performers' Collective is also an examination center for the above-mentioned boards.
